Biography of Tom Cruise
Tom Cruise, born on July 3, 1962, in Syracuse, New York, is an iconic American actor and producer. He is known for his roles in blockbuster films and is one of the highest-paid actors in Hollywood.
Personal Information | Details |
---|---|
Full Name | Thomas Cruise Mapother IV |
Date of Birth | July 3, 1962 |
Place of Birth | Syracuse, New York, USA |
Occupation | Actor, Producer |
Height | 5 ft 7 in (170 cm) |
Notable Works | Top Gun, Mission: Impossible series, Jerry Maguire |
Height Facts
Tom Cruise’s height is often reported as 5 feet 7 inches (170 cm). While this may seem average compared to many leading men in Hollywood, it is worth noting that height can be misleading in the film industry, where camera angles, footwear, and the presence of other tall actors can create different perceptions.
- Tom Cruise's height has often been a topic of debate among fans and critics.
- He is known to wear specially designed shoes to enhance his height on-screen.
- Despite his height, Cruise has successfully played numerous leading roles alongside taller co-stars.

Comparisons with Other Actors
Height is often a subject of comparison among actors. Tom Cruise has worked with many taller co-stars, including:
- Brad Pitt - 5 ft 11 in (180 cm)
- Matthew McConaughey - 5 ft 11 in (180 cm)
- Cameron Diaz - 5 ft 9 in (175 cm)
Despite these height differences, Cruise's performances have often outshone the physical disparities, proving that talent and screen presence are more critical than height.
